About this property
A large Victorian detached family home set in a generous size plot within strolling distance Stone town centre. Holly House offers a wealth of period features along with spacious and flexible accommodation comprising; reception hall, living room, Amdega conservatory, dining room, breakfast kitchen, pantry, inner hallway, utility and guest cloakroom. To the first floor there are four bedrooms, a study, family bathroom and separate WC. Moving to the outside the house enjoys large private walled gardens with greenhouse and gateway to the canal side, and is approached via a private driveway providing generous off road parking before a double garage, stable and coach house.
All in all a fabulous period family house in the most convenient of locations, with a host of amenities quite literally on the doorstep and within easy reach of commuter routes.
